I'm brand new here and I wanted to see the thoughts of the more seasoned people out there about my new/first computer build (if what I have is sufficient or if I should or need to buy something of higher quality). While I do play video games, it's not my first concern; my primary focus is rendering for editing software such as computer animation, video editing, and other art oriented things. Below will be the list of what was put on the printout of what I bought so forgive me if there's a more proper term for what's listed.

-WH14NS40 16x Internal Blu-Ray Rewriter

- ASRock Z97 Extreme 4 LGA 1150 ATX Intel Motherboard

-ASUS GeForce GTX 970 Overclocked 4GB DDR5 Video Card

-Cooler Master Hyper 212 EVO Universal CPU Cooler

-Corsair Carbide Series 300R Mid-Tower ATX Gaming Computer Case

-Crucial Ballistix Sport 16 GB DDR3-1600 (PC3-12800) CL9 Dual Channel Desktop Memory Kit (Two 8GB Memory Modules)

-EVGA 600B 600 Watt ATX Power Supply

-Intel Core i7-4790k 4.0GHz LGA 1150 Boxed Processor

-Samsung 850 EVO Series 250GB SATA III 6GB/s 2.5" Internal SSD Single Unit Version MZ-75E250B/AM

-WD Desktop Mainstream 1TB 7,200 RPM SATA 6.0GB/s 3.5" Internal Hard Drive

I didn't include extras like the monitor, keyboard, etc. since they aren't a priority to me. If I missed anything please let me know and thanks in advance for any assistance.
